2012 West Park Arts Fest: Friends Across Cultures

 

FRIENDS ACROSS CULTURES

MORE THAN 25 CULTURAL AND COMMUNITY PARTNERS ARE JOINING WEST PARK CULTURAL CENTER TO CREATE AN UNFORGETTABLE DAY

A FUN DAY OF FREE PERFORMANCES AND ACTIVITIES FOR THE ENTIRE FAMILY

On the grounds and inside the School of the Future from 11:00am - 5:00pm:

  • INDEPENDENT ARTIST STAGE with 14 music acts hosted by Lil' Drummaboy Productions. Acts include Ashley Super and harmony, TImi Tanzania, PASCOE King of Kings, IRIS, Ralph Collins, The Philadelphia Electro Orchestra, Gretchen Elyse Walker, Black Broccoli, Monica McIntyre, School of the Future Jazz Ensemble, School of the Future rappers and singers
  • MAINSTAGE with the Multicultural Children's Choir and International Opera Theatre, CAMERATA Philadelphia, Universal Drum and Dance Ensemble and Urban Suburban Film Festival
  • Streetscape Performance Area with singer and tap dancer Brianae Ali, West Philadelphia Senior Community Center Line Dancers, Gospel Choir, Poetry Slam, and more...
  • Children's Pavilion featuring drawing workshops with Janice Merendino, book give-a-ways with Tree House Books, storytelling, arts and crafts and more...
  • Arts, Craft, and Food Vendors
  • Franklin Institute Backpack Science
  • Tangle Movement Arts aerial acrobatic performance
  • Chosen Dance Company hip hop dance performance
  • Dancin' On Air
  • Settlement Music School Jazz Ensemble and solo performers
  • KYO DAIKO Japanese Drumming
  • Consulate General of Italy in Phialdelphia presenting mask making workshops, Tarentella Dance demonstrations, Strolling musician, Commedia dell'Arte - Italian Comedy
